![]() The focus of adding these new foods was to be more sensitive to those who have sensitive dietary restrictions, such as being lactose-intolerant. “Together, these changes confirm the program can meet the diverse nutritional needs of mothers, children, and infants, especially in times of chaos, confusion, and need.”Īdding these foods to the WIC Approved Food List gives participants the ability to have a broader selection to choose from when shopping. ![]() “This better serves West Virginians by supporting a diet rich in fiber, vitamins, and nutrients, and it also reflects the ability of WIC to adapt and respond to participant requests,” said Emma Walters, Nutrition Services Coordinator with the West Virginia WIC Program. WIC food packages and nutrition education are the chief means by which WIC affects the dietary. Changes made to the list come from participant feedback within the WIC program. The WIC food packages provide supplemental foods designed to meet the special nutritional needs of low-income pregnant, breastfeeding, non-breastfeeding postpartum women, infants and children up to five years of age who are at nutritional risk. ![]() ![]() CHARLESTON, WV (WVNS) - The WV Department of Health and Human Resources (DHHR) and Bureau for Public Health announced the expansion of foods available for purchase through the Special Supplemental Nutrition Program for Women, Infants, and Children (WIC).Īccording to a DHHR press release, the new foods were added to encourage healthier eating habits and meet greater nutritional needs.
